About Oxford Biotherapeutics

Oxford Biotherapeutics is a clinical-stage biotechnology company specializing in antibody therapeutics for cancer treatment. We focus on discovering new antibody-based oncology therapeutics using our OGAP verify platform, the world's largest cancer-specific membrane protein library. Our pipeline includes novel biologics, with our lead asset, OBT076, in Phase 1b clinical development. We collaborate with industry leaders like Roche and Boehringer Ingelheim.

Purpose of the Role

The role involves laboratory research to identify new cancer therapeutic targets, utilizing techniques such as proteomics, mass spectrometry, human tissue analysis, and data analysis. Adherence to regulatory standards and general lab duties are also required. Training will be provided.

Roles and Responsibilities
  • Conduct laboratory experiments and processing of human tissues.
  • Operate mass spectrometers and chromatography systems.
  • Ensure compliance with health, safety, and tissue handling regulations.
  • Prioritize tasks to meet project goals and team objectives.
  • Cultivate cell lines and maintain laboratory equipment.
  • Record, analyze, and interpret experimental data.
Knowledge, Experience, and Skills
  • BSc in Biology, Biochemistry, or related field; MSc preferred.
  • Experience with mammalian cell culture or human tissues is desirable.
  • Ability to follow SOPs and work confidently in a lab environment.
  • Accurate record-keeping skills.
  • Willingness to be vaccinated against Hepatitis B if not already vaccinated.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office; experience with proteomics and mass spectrometry is a plus.
  • Attention to detail and strong communication skills.
  • Ability to work independently and maintain confidentiality.
